Project Control Manager


Community Transit


Location

Everett, WA | United States


Job description

As Manager of Project Control, you will play a crucial role in establishing and guiding the Project Control function within the agency. Your primary responsibility will be to apply advanced technical and management knowledge to develop a compelling business case justifying the creation of the Project Control function. This function is a novel addition to the agency and vital for oversight of large capital programs with significant scope, size, and complexity.

Collaborating with the Procurement and Contracts Manager and Disadvantaged Business Enterprise Liaison Officer, you will serve as the Subject Matter Expert on project schedule, cost estimates, and budgeting. Your role involves providing support and guidance to project managers in contract administration to ensure compliance with procurement policies and procedures while minimizing costs. 

  1. Develop and administer Project Control policies and procedures for effective management and control of cost, contingency, change, and procurement in capital programs. Ensure seamless integration of Project Control with financial, contract, and project management. Guarantee consistent interpretation and application of processes, policies, and practices, while ensuring compliance with relevant laws and regulations.
  2. Oversee, prepare, and/or reviews cost estimates, budgets, and reports, documenting planned versus actual budget performance. Conduct and interpret earned value, monitor trends, and prepare cost forecasts on a daily and monthly basis.
  3. Provide technical and expert support to project managers in developing baseline cost estimates and schedules. Ensure full integration of scope, schedule, costs, risk, and resources. Control changes to projects and contract through formalized change control procedures.
  4. Support the Project Manager in overseeing consultants and/or related project contractors, ensuring quality work products and timelines.
  5. Support project managers using scheduling techniques to develop and maintain accurate cost and schedules. Review contractor monthly schedule submissions and prepare or review reports.
  6. Assist in developing and implementing integrated program management and control tools, techniques, and methods on a daily basis.
  7. Support project managers in maintaining the project risk register. Review the risk register with major stakeholders and conveying mitigation plans to appropriate risk managers on an annual basis.
  8. Provide training, outreach, and change management communication to the department project managers, customers, and partners for the successful establishment of the Project Control function.
  9. Perform other duties of a similar nature or level.
